Output e3fb51248efd34ea57428a8091c3858790edb40970aa9ea7a84c62eac4bcfad2:7

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d2a5072565617e957a9d63c039e92898a85088079bf19b894c1976bb81be03e
address
tb1pd549qujk2ct7j4af6c7q885j3x9g2zyq0xl3nwy5cxtkhwqmuqlq48rlee
transaction
e3fb51248efd34ea57428a8091c3858790edb40970aa9ea7a84c62eac4bcfad2
confirmations
49874
spent
true